Transaction 61a32be742212343c6247cdf72bb55e5d04b2f2c987fd75683e56f5b357caca5
1 Input
1 Output
-
61a32be742212343c6247cdf72bb55e5d04b2f2c987fd75683e56f5b357caca5:0
- value
- 2025671
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cdf507e45b98d30a7f08b776f1437a13c302a17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 181Tsjmx66z9CvBsuWPzvhWDvEQg5nx9yK